Abstract
Papers contained in this volume were prepared for the XV East Asia Net (EAN) Research Workshop, held at University Ca’ Foscari of Venice in Spring 2015. The workshop addressed two themes: the nature-culture-society nexus and cultural diplomacy. Works featured in this book draw from a variety of disciplinary and methodological approaches, representative of the the current trends in multidisciplinary research in the field of Asian Studies.
